For 150 years, Holland America Line has been a recognized leader in cruising, taking our guests to exotic destinations around the world. We are committed to our mission: Through excellence, we create once-in-a-lifetime experiences, every time. Today, Holland America Line's fleet of 11 modern classic ships offers more than 500 sailings a year visiting all seven continents. Cruises include both popular and less-traveled ports in the Caribbean, Alaska, Europe, Mexico, South America, the Panama Canal, Australia, New Zealand and Asia — as well as unique voyages to the Amazon, Antarctica and our extended Grand Voyages. Cruise Administration Services Inc. (CASI), a Carnival Cruise Line entity in the Philippines currently has a Manager, Case Management & Clinical Operations role available. Only candidates located in the Philippines to apply.

Job Summary:

This role reports to the Senior Manager of Case Management and oversees the daily operations of crew case management. The Manager leads a team of specialists to ensure timely, empathetic communication and resolution of high-complexity cases involving clinical, legal, and logistical challenges.

Key responsibilities include reviewing care plans, coordinating with internal stakeholders, supporting disability claims, and facilitating return-to-work planning. The Manager also escalates high-risk cases, conducts utilization reviews, and represents the company in arbitration when needed.

Operationally, the role supports shipboard medical teams, participates in the 24/7 duty rotation, and manages onboard referrals and disembarkations. The Manager monitors performance metrics, drives continuous improvement, and leads the development of the crew health programs, and policy development.

This position requires strong knowledge of cruise ship medicine, maritime regulations, and crew health standards, and involves collaboration across brands, medical teams, and external providers.

Essential Functions:

Case Management Oversight

·Manage high-complexity cases involving clinical challenges, cases in port, legal and regulatory risks, and logistical constraints. 
·Coordinate and communicate with medical providers, legal, HR, and case management teams to ensure appropriate, timely care delivery. 
·Communicate with seafarers and their families with professionalism and empathy. 
·Review clinical care plans for appropriateness and support the case management team in decision-making. 
·Oversee care coordination for referred and disembarked crew, ensuring adherence to evidence-based and cost-effective practices. 
·Facilitate crew return-to-work planning in compliance with regulations and employment obligations. 
·Support disability claims and benefits review for crew unable to return to duty. 
·Collaborate with the crew health team to assess fitness for duty per International Maritime Health standards.

Crew Medical Claims Management

·Escalate high-risk crew cases to risk management, legal, HR, and clinical governance teams. 
·Review crew claims for relevance and appropriateness in coordination with internal and external legal teams. 
·Represent the corporation in arbitration proceedings related to crew medical cases. 
·Lead investigations into complaints or concerns regarding crew medical issues. 
·Conduct utilization reviews to assess medical necessity and customary costs and contribute to documentation accuracy. 
·Identify areas of improvement with healthcare providers and assistance companies and work with necessary stakeholders to build relationships, improve workflows and grow healthcare networks. 

Operational Support

·Provide logistical and clinical support to shipboard medical teams, especially for complex cases. 
·Work with the Health Operations Center to serve as a resource and for medical emergencies, medevacs, public health concerns, and other critical crew health issues. 
·Coordinate onboard care referrals and disembarkation processes. 
·Participate in the 24/7 duty schedule for crew medical support.
·Support the Senior Manager of Case Management in developing and maintaining policies and procedures for crew health and case management. 
·Conduct quality assurance and patient satisfaction audits to ensure compliance and continuous improvement.

Team Management

·Coach and performance manage the case management team to meet or exceed productivity and quality goals. 
·Establish and promote best practices and workflows for case management, including coordination with assistance companies. 
·Collaborate with internal departments to ensure aligned and well-coordinated health initiatives. 
·Monitor key performance indicators, population health data and produce recurring reports on case management metrics. 

Crew Health Programs

·Identify illness trends and lead the development of preventative and screening health programs based on medical evidence. 
·Train and work with shipboard and shoreside medical teams to implement and monitor effects of health programs.

Qualifications:

  •  Must have a medical background with knowledge in occupational health, family practice, legal policies, and procedures. 
  • Ability to apply analytical and logistic skills; maintain attention to detail and accuracy. 
  • Minimum 3 years supervisory experience and 7 or more years in clinical or related administration position. Preferred to have at least 2 years of clinical practice on cruise ships.
